Windows 10 Start Menu isn't responding.
Open Windows PowerShell with admin rights. Click the Start button, select Command Prompt (Admin), type "Powershell" in the black window and press Enter. In the Administrator Windows PowerShell window, paste the following command and hit Enter: Get-AppXPackage -AllUsers | Foreach {Add-AppxPackage -DisableDevelopmentMode -Register "$($_.InstallLocation)\AppXManifest.xml"}. Wait for the process to finish. Then try pressing Start and see if it works.
